Handover note for the security review of Spindlegate's canary gating rules: promotion from 5% to 50% traffic is currently gated on error-rate and latency thresholds only — the auth-failure metric was removed last quarter and never restored, which I consider a gap worth flagging. Gate evaluation runs in the deploy controller with cluster-admin scope, so any rule change is effectively privileged. I've documented each gate, its data source, and its override history on the internal review page.

runbook for badug-kadup: https://confluence.zemvarlabs.internal/projects/browse/display/projects/bd1b

### 2.8.1 — Key rotation (password reset revamp)

As part of the Hollins Identity reset-flow revamp, reset tokens are now minted by the new Gatewell service instead of the legacy monolith. Token lifetime dropped from 60 to 15 minutes, and single-use enforcement is server-side. Because the old signing material was shared with the monolith, we rotated it during this release. New team members should note that all reset emails are now signed with the key below.

signing key of bagap-yawep = bky13_TbfT6ZMUoGJo2

### Step 4: Health Checks

Before cutting traffic to the new Varnholt pool, configure the load balancer to probe the dedicated health endpoint rather than the root path, which requires auth. Probes must pass three consecutive checks before a node joins rotation. The checker process reads its parameters at startup; the current values are as follows.

service settings:
BELYS_PIN=8148
BELYS_TENANT=lamius
BELYS_METRICS_HOST=metrics.belys.tolvaqlabs.internal
BELYS_SEAL=seal_dc8ee71f
BELYS_STANDBY_TEAM=praix